What does a Design Engineer Manager do?

A Design Engineer Manager leads a team of design engineers in developing, testing, and refining products or systems. They oversee project timelines, coordinate with other departments, and ensure that design solutions meet technical, quality, and budget requirements. Additionally, they provide technical guidance, mentor their team, and often contribute to the hiring and training processes. Their role is crucial for bridging the gap between engineering and management, ensuring that projects are delivered efficiently and meet organizational goals.

Is mem better than mba?

For a Design Engineer Manager, an MBA provides broader business and leadership skills, which can enhance management and strategic decision-making. An MEM (Master of Engineering Management) focuses more on technical leadership and engineering project management. The choice depends on whether the role requires more business acumen or technical management expertise.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Design Engineer Man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Design Engineer Manager, you need a strong background in engineering principles, project management, and leadership, often supported by a bachelor's or master's degree in engineering and relevant management experience. Familiarity with CAD software, product lifecycle management (PLM) systems, and certifications like PMP or Six Sigma are typically valuable. Excellent communication, problem-solving, and team-building skills help you motivate and guide multidisciplinary teams. These skills ensure effective project execution, innovation, and the successful delivery of complex engineering solutions.

GK Systems, a General Kinematics’ Brand, is a premier leader in the design and integration of recycling and foundry systems. Whether it’s the complete design and manufacture of a greenfield project, complicated retrofits, or system upgrades, GK Systems is the one stop shop.


We are currently looking for a qualified Design Engineer to join our team. This position is responsible for the development, design, and analysis of complex recycling and foundry systems. The ideal candidate will have direct experience with the design, layout, and ROI analysis of capital equipment projects and will thrive in a collaborative environment working alongside Production Engineering, Customer Service, and Sales. If you are passionate about engineering innovation, customer-driven design, and delivering high-quality industrial systems, we want to hear from you.


Job Responsibilities

· Lead and participate in the development and design of complete system layouts for recycling, foundry, and industrial processing applications, from concept through detailed design.

· Create, review, and modify engineering drawings and 3D models in conformance with GK standards to accurately and clearly define equipment, assemblies, and parts for manufacture, ensuring all deliverables meet quality and schedule requirements.

· Utilize Revit, Autodesk Construction Cloud, Inventor, and AutoCAD to produce complete, accurate drawing packages for internal manufacturing and external customer use, including BOM generation, general arrangement drawings, and installation documentation.

· Continuously develop and apply engineering design, structural analysis, CAD, and manufacturing knowledge, with a focus on deepening expertise in GK equipment and vibratory system technology.

· Support new market development initiatives by contributing technical insight to product positioning, application engineering, and identification of opportunities to expand GK Systems’ capabilities into adjacent industries.

· Partner proactively with Sales and Project Management teams to develop technically sound and commercially competitive proposals, including system sizing, equipment selection, and preliminary design concepts that address customer requirements and budget constraints.

· Integrate safety as a core design principle in all system layouts and equipment designs, adhering to applicable OSHA standards, ANSI/ASME codes, and GK internal safety guidelines to protect personnel and ensure regulatory compliance.

· Drive cost efficiency through design optimization, value engineering, and standardization of components, actively identifying opportunities to reduce material and fabrication costs without compromising quality or performance.

· Leverage available engineering tools, simulation software, and emerging technology to enhance design accuracy, accelerate project timelines, and improve overall team productivity.

· Fully support the Company’s ISO objectives, policies and procedures.

Requirements:

· Bachelor’s degree in Mechanical Engineering or related engineering discipline from an accredited institution.

· 2+ years of engineering experience designing capital industrial equipment such as conveyors, vibratory systems, material handling equipment, or process machinery is strongly preferred; recent graduates with relevant internship or co-op experience will be considered.

· Strong analytical and problem-solving skills, with the ability to systematically diagnose engineering challenges, evaluate design alternatives, and implement effective, well-documented solutions under project constraints.

· Demonstrated understanding of basic business concepts, project economics, and the ability to translate customer requirements into viable engineering solutions, communicating technical content clearly to both technical and non-technical audiences.

· Proven ability to take ownership of assignments, manage competing priorities, meet deadlines, and proactively drive tasks to completion with minimal supervision.

· Excellent interpersonal, communication, and organizational skills, with a collaborative mindset and the ability to work effectively across cross-functional teams including Engineering, Sales, Manufacturing, and Customer Service.

· Strong attention to detail with a commitment to producing accurate, complete, and professional engineering documentation and drawings.

· Pro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ite (Word, Excel, Outlook, PowerPoint); hands-on experience with Autodesk Inventor, AutoCAD, and/or Revit required. Experience with Autodesk Construction Cloud, FEA tools, or other simulation software is a plus.
